Description

PA007634.r2c: In Vivo Grade Recombinant Anti-mouse Thy-1 Monoclonal Antibody (Clone: YBM 29.2.1), Rat IgG2c Kappa

Recombinant Rat IgG2c Monoclonal Antibody.
Clone: YBM 29.2.1.
Isotype: Rat IgG2c kappa.
Source: The anti-mouse Thy-1 monoclonal antibody (clone: YBM 29.2.1) was produced in mammalian cells.
Specificity/Sensitivity: The in vivo grade recombinant rat monoclonal antibody (clone: YBM 29.2.1) specifically binds to mouse Thy-1.
Applications: ELISA, neutralization, functional assays such as bioanalytical PK and ADA assays, and those assays for studying biological pathways affected by the mouse Thy-1 protein.
Form of Antibody: 0.2 uM filtered solution, pH 7.4, no stabilizers or preservatives.
Endotoxin: < 1 EU per 1 mg of the protein by the LAL method.
Purity: >95% by SDS-PAGE under reducing conditions and HPLC.

Shipping: The in vivo grade recombinant anti-mouse Thy-1 monoclonal antibody of clone YBM 29.2.1 is shipped with ice pack. Upon receipt, store it immediately at the temperature recommended below.
Stability & Storage: Use a manual defrost freezer and av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les.
12 months from date of receipt, -20 to -70°C as supplied.
1 month from date of receipt, 2 to 8°C as supplied.
